<h3>Dan Wright</h3>
<blockquote><p>Dan is best known as one-half of the double-act &#8216;Electric Forecast&#8217;. Together with double-act partner, Steve Marsh, he has appeared in a numerous television shows for BBC 3, Ch4, Ch5, MTV, SKY, ITV &amp; E4. Dan and Steve have also co-devised a couple of magazine-style shows for Sky.</p>
<p>As well as his double-act work Dan is also an actor and presenter in his own right, with a number of TV credits to his name.</p>

<h3>Geoff Norcott</h3>
<blockquote><p>Everything Geoff Norcott does is under-pinned by enthusiasm, optimism and a sharp comic mind. Whether it be on the comedy circuit, where Geoff’s abundance of energy combined with a storming mix of observations, impressions and satire has made him a hugely popular act both in the UK and abroad. Or on television, where Geoff recently went from co-presenter to become the main anchor on the ETV’s WKD Shed Sports Show &#8211; his sharp one-liners becoming a popular feature of the nightly debates.</p>
<p>Geoff has also starred in “Spoof”, an impressions show for BBC1, and recently filmed a comedy drama pilot for the BBC alongside Alexander Armstrong. Geoff’s growing number of radio appearances include frequent guest spots on Talksport, where he endeavours to see the funny side of cricket and regular spots on BBC Radio 5, including Andy Zaltzman’s “Yes, It’s The Ashes”.</p>
<p>As a former English literature teacher, Geoff is a refreshing and humorous commentator on any issues related to education. He is also emerging as a vibrant writer, having written for ‘The Now Show’ (BBC Radio 4), ‘Parsons &amp; Naylor’ (BBC Radio 2) &amp; comedy sketches for MTV. In 2007 &amp; 2008 he was also a commissioned writer for Nuts TV, writing and presenting a daily sports show. He’s currently devising a new sketch show for CBBC.</p>
<p>This year Geoff had a very successful run at the Edinburgh Fringe with his second solo show, “The Shocking Truth About Men And Women”.</p>

<h3>Paul Ricketts</h3>
<blockquote><p>Paul tried his hand as a musician, playwright, pornographer, chimney sweep, stage hand and primary school teacher before turning to stand-up comedy on the advice of his therapist. His black, sub – urban humour on everyday, topical and satirical subjects is now in demand.</p>
<p>In 2006 Paul co-hosted his first Edinburgh fringe show &#8211; &#8216;Peter Friends&#8217; at the Roxy Art House. A year later he was part of a late night show as part of the Laughing Horse free festival, performed at the Smirnoff Underbelly and MC-d &#8216;Pretty Dirty Things&#8217; which received a four star review from ONE4REVIEW.COM. In 2008 Paul hosted &#8216;Up The Arts Comedy Lock-In&#8217; to packed audience as part of the PBH Free Fringe and performed his first solo hour show &#8216;Paul Ricketts &amp; Buff Wood &#8211; Wood Pushers&#8217; awarded five stars from THREE WEEKS.</p>
<p>Live comedy including: Comedy Store, Just The Tonic, Outside the Box, Comedy Café, Downstairs At The Kings Head, Bearcat Comedy, Falling Down With Laughter, Fun @ The Funhouse, Paul is the regular MC at Up The Arts comedy clubs.</p>

<h3>Colin Cole</h3>
<blockquote><p>Colin is literally one of the biggest names in comedy in Australia &#8211; not only is he 6&#8242; 7&#8243;, he is also known for his hugely dynamic performance. His delivery is fast and furious, and his material ranges from the topical to the observational. As well as comedy, Colin has been an actor for many years, and in this field he is known for his versatility and he is a very much sought-after performer.</p>
<p>Colin is a highly skilled and experienced performer, his ability to break barriers with this universally funny material makes him appealing to a wide range of audience. He has toured extensively in the US, Canada and Hawaii, and now he’s also taking the UK by storm.</p>

<h3>Hal Cruttenden</h3>
<blockquote><p>Hal Cruttenden is one of the one of the top comedians working in the UK today, as well as being an accomplished writer and actor. Already this year he has appeared on &#8216;Rob Brydon&#8217;s Annually Retentive&#8217; for BBC3 and has just finished writing and performing in &#8216;The Omid Djalili Show&#8217; due to be aired on BBC1 towards the end of the year.</p>
<p>His other television credits include, &#8216;The 11 O&#8217;Clock Show&#8217;, (Channel 4), &#8216;Brain Candy&#8217; (BBC3), &#8216;Live at Jongleurs&#8217; (UK Gold/Paramount), &#8216;The Comedy Store&#8217; (Paramount) &#8216;The World Stands Up&#8217; (Paramount Comedy Channel UK, The Comedy Channel Australia, and Comedy Central and BBC America in the U.S), &#8216;The Warehouse&#8217; (Carlton TV), &#8216;Carlton Comedy Warehouse&#8217; (Carlton/STV), &#8216;The Deputy Prime Minister&#8217; (BBC2), &#8216;Hoot&#8217; (Bravo), &#8216;Net.Comedy&#8217; (Action Time), &#8216;Daily Telegraph Open Mic Awards&#8217; (Channel 5) and &#8216;House of Fun&#8217; (Meridien). He has also warmed up at the BBC for &#8216;The Jonathan Ross Show&#8217; and the &#8216;Keith Barrett Show&#8217; in addition to hosting the recordings for &#8216;The World Stands Up&#8217; at The Clapham Grand.</p>
<p>Hal&#8217;s big breakthrough in stand up came with his nomination for the Perrier Newcomer Award at the 2002 Edinburgh Festival for his solo show &#8216;Hal&#8217;, followed by a highly successful run the following year of his second show, &#8216;To Hal and Back&#8217;, which was also performed at the Soho Theatre in London at the end of 2003. At the 2005 Edinburgh Festival, he performed sketches with &#8216;The Monkey Butlers&#8217; to sell out crowds at the Underbelly Venue. He is a regular performer at all the top UK clubs, including the Comedy Store and Jongleurs, and supported Ardal O&#8217;Hanlon and Omid Djalili on their recent nationwide tours.</p>
<p>Internationally, Hal received rave reviews at the Just for Laughs Comedy Festival in Montreal in 2004 and at the Kilkenny Cat Laughs Comedy Festival in 2005. He has done shows throughout the Netherlands, Belgium, and Ireland, and even further afield in Abu Dhabi, Dubai, Qatar, Kuwait, Bahrain, Jakarta, Canada, Shanghai, Hong Kong and Singapore, where he appeared at the Jubilee Hall in the world famous Raffles Hotel. He performed at the opening of the first comedy venue in Bali and, earlier this year, did a week of shows to the Armed Forces in the Falkland Islands!</p></blockquote>
